The quickest flight from Qingdao to Budapest takes around 20h 8m. Flights depart from Qingdao Jiaodong International Airport (TAO) and arrive at Budapest Liszt Ferenc International Airport (BUD).
Scheduled flights between Qingdao Jiaodong International Airport (TAO) and Budapest Liszt Ferenc International Airport (BUD) depart every 1-2 days. These flights are serviced by Korean Air and China Southern Airlines and the typical transit time is around 20h 8m.
No, it doesn't look like there are dedicated Cargo planes flying between Qingdao and Budapest. There are regular passenger aircraft however and they might be able to accommodate your cargo depending on its dimensions and weight.
The distance between Qingdao and Budapest by cargo ship is 11,352 Nautical Miles (21,024 Kilometres / 13,063 Miles). This distance is measured by sea between Qingdao (CNQDG) and Hamburg (DEHAM).
The distance between Qingdao and Budapest by air is around 8,727 Kilometres (5,423 Miles). This distance is measured following typical flight paths between Qingdao Jiaodong International Airport (TAO) and Budapest Liszt Ferenc International Airport (BUD).
770kg CO₂e (per TEU) is the estimated emissions output (CO2e) when transporting a typical shipping container (1 TEU) from Qingdao to Budapest. This is calculated using the overall historical emissions of the average container ship on this trade lane and dividing it by the total projected capacity.
441kg CO₂e (per 100kg) is the estimated emissions output (CO2e) when sending cargo by air from Qingdao to Budapest. This is calculated by determining the total fuel burn output of various aircraft that typically fly this route and dividing it by the total available cargo capacity in KGs.
